Description Dmitriy Plutalovskiy 2013-11-19 09:15:56 UTC
When I connect to Win Server 2008 by rdp using non-standard resolution modes(current desktop resolution, another resolution, current Krdc window size) the pictures are deform. All work perfectly on standard resolution like 1024x768, 1280x1024 etc.
See thread http://forum.kde.org/viewtopic.php?f=18&t=118417&p=296684#p296684
Xfreerdp from console work properly in all cases. Remmina too.
I try 16bit, 24bit, 32bit color depth but nothing change.

Reproducible: Always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. create new connection
2. select current desktop resolution or another resolution or current Krdc window size
3. click connect
Actual Results:  
I'm connect to server. Pictures deform on screen. Additionaly  I see lines, rectangles etc like in screenshots, that randomly appear on screen.

Expected Results:  
Remote screen without artefacts.
